Bellum K9 Inc, located at 13626a Montgomery Rd, Santa Fe, TX 77510, is a veteran-owned dog training facility that offers exceptional services for dog owners seeking to improve their pets’ behavior. This dog park in Santa Fe, TX, is fully accessible with wheelchair-friendly entrances, parking, restrooms, and seating, making it an inclusive and welcoming environment for all visitors. The park also features gender-neutral restrooms, enhancing its commitment to accessibility and comfort for every guest.
What makes Bellum K9 Inc unique is its hands-on training approach that not only transforms dogs but also educates owners on effective training techniques. Many local dog owners have praised the trainers for their dedication and success in managing reactive or difficult dogs, turning them into well-behaved companions. Whether you’re looking for expert dog training or a pet-friendly spot with supportive amenities, Bellum K9 Inc stands out as a top choice for dog-friendly hiking and pet-friendly trails in the Santa Fe area.

Watch out for these guys. They took our money. 1,000 dollars. We told them that we were not interested in E collar training, and definitely not interested in off leash training due to Galveston county’s strict leash laws. I put down 1k as a deposit. They were adamant that no training would begin until it was paid in full. Then, upon my request they sent me a ten week training course which included training that we don’t want, ie e collar, and off leash training. We told them what our specific needs were but they ignored us. They brag about being fellow veterans. They brag about exclusive 3 million dollar contracts. But they will steal 1k from a fellow veteran without any services being provided. Pathetic, way pathetic. Be very careful with this place
If you want to make a sizable donation and not get much in return then this is the place for you!!We paid upfront for four weeks of training and we were going to pay more the next month for two more weeks. Thank God we didn’t pay it all upfront but we still lost a lot of money and we quit coming after the third week of training because it was unprofessional and a waste of time.First red flag should have been that they were so adamant that there were no refunds not even if your dog died before training could start! Anyway we were stupid and handed over the money then came for first day of training and it wasn’t the owner the person that we interviewed with it, no it was this girl who was not professional cussed like a sailor and spent our first one hour class all on how to put the herm springer collar on our dog which we could have learned in like 10 minutes. She said the same thing over and over again didn’t do one bit of training and then we left got in the car and we were like what did we just do.Second week we show up and because the owner had fired the girl he was now going to be the trainer and we thought ok this will be better but he didn’t show for the appointment and when we called we had to reschedule he wasn’t feeling well.So second visit again they tell us to bring your dog hungry so he will work for treats well poor thing was hungry and there were no treats and he had sent someone out to buy some and in the meantime he talked and talked and talked and repeated himself and no actual training was done. He did try to upsell us and said well there is only so much we can do in four one hour sessions you really need to add more weeks but I had already given him 2000 dollars for nothing so I wasn’t about to do anymore. We then came for our third session and agin there was no plan no rhyme or reason and he couldn’t remember what week we were on and he got his folder out that had clients paperwork and then just sat it down and started talking saying some of the same things he had already said the previous class.We decided the fourth and final class wasn’t worth going to because it was just that bad!!I’m so irritated that we handed over that kind of money to someone that had no plan whatsoever, and had no professionalism. We interviewed with some other really good dog trainers before going with Bellum K9, but the Bellum K9 guys were very good salesmen, I’ll give them that, but the training experience was abysmal so please don’t waste your money or your time!!
